Who are the Strictly Come Dancing 2026 couples?
Everyone has been matched with a pro dancer – and these include several of the new five professionals to join Strictly this series.
Fans saw them paired in a fun ‘speed dancing’ segment. They all learned the same routine and were told to switch partners multiple times as they performed it.
Whoever the celebrity was dancing with when the music stopped is now their partner for the rest of the series!
The Strictly Come Dancing 2026 couples are:
- Bethany Antonia and Nancy Xu
- Cach Mercer and Maddie Ingoldsby
- Chris Appleton and Amy Dowden
- Dani Dyer and Nikita Kuzmin
- Delta Goodrem and Kai Widdrington
- Graeme Hall and Lauren Oakley
- Jaime Winstone and Carlos Gu
- John Nellis and Katya Jones
- Lacey Turner and Vito Coppola
- Lawrence Robb and Jowita Przystał
- Melanie Walters and Aljaž Škorjanec
- Dame Sarah Storey and Julian Caillon
- Shaun Wright-Phillips and Alexis Warr
- Tabby Stoecker and Mark Karmalita
- Will Best and Dianne Buswell

When you can vote for your favourite Strictly couple
Tonight’s launch show was pre-recorded. This means fans are currently unable to vote for their favourite couple. And unfortunately, there’s a bit of a wait if you’re already rooting for one pair.
The first Strictly Come Dancing 2026 live show will air next Saturday (September 26, 2026). Each of the couples will be taking to the ballroom and performing their opening routine.
However, they can rest assured that no one can vote them off. Only the judges get to vote in the Week 1 live show. They will then carry their votes over to Week 2, which airs on Saturday, October 3.
And then finally, the vote lines will be open! The public vote and judges’ Week 1 and 2 scores will be combined and result in the first Strictly dance off of 2026.
This will take place in Sunday October 4’s show. Can’t wait!
